STEM LOGO300Science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(S.T.E.M.) is a fast-growing academic emphasis among schools preparing their students for an exciting and yet unknown future. Timothy Christian School recognizes this and offers S.T.E.M. opportunities early to its students. First grade students began the year by learning to program computers through playing with robots in the classroom.  Using the newest robotic technology, Dash and Dot, and a classroom Ipad, students are able to command a robot’s movements and path. An example of play based learning, this type of classroom activity is exposing children to the vocabulary and patterns that computer programmers use on a daily basis.
